Chianti with kids

Gardens to run in, a real castle, gelato, and treasure in the woods. A day that keeps small people happy and grown-ups drinking well.

  1. 10:00
    VignamaggioGreve in Chianti

    Formal gardens to run around and an easy villa-and-vines visit. Grape juice for the little ones while you taste.

  2. 12:00
    Gelato on Piazza Matteotti

    Back in Greve, the big square has the gelato and the space for kids to roam while you sit with a coffee.

  3. 13:30
    Castello di MeletoGaiole in Chianti

    A real 11th-century castle with tours — drawbridge energy for the kids, Guelph-and-Ghibelline history for you.

  4. 15:30
    Truffle hunting in the woodsChianti woods

    Book a short family hunt: a dog, a forest and buried treasure. The most kid-proof thing a wine region has ever offered.
